VSTS DACPAC部署

问题描述 投票:-1回答:1

我想自动化数据库部署。我们正在使用SQL Server Azure。我们需要使用Dacpac自动化数据库部署。我导入了数据库并进行了一些更改并通过SSDT发布,它没有任何问题也很好用,为了使用Execute Azure SQL:DacpacTask在VSTS中自动执行脚本,我需要有一个Dacpac文件,我创建了dacpac文件,我们在不同环境中拥有不同的用户。我想不要删除不在源数据库中的表。如果我们从SSDT发布它,我们可以在发布时更改它的部署设置。由于我将在VSTS中使用此DACPAC,我只想知道如何忽略不在源中的删除用户/表。我虽然我可以在调试下更改它,但所有复选框都在那里禁用。更改将在VSTS中执行的dacpac文件的部署设置的正确方法是什么。

azure-devops dacpac
1个回答
0
投票

您可以在Additional SqlPackage.exe Arguments框中指定其他SqlPackage.exe参数:

enter image description here

© www.soinside.com 2019 - 2024. All rights reserved.